How Do You Soften A Lemon In The Microwave?

Microwave it! Warming up the fruit for 15-20 seconds softens its insides. This lets you get the most lemony goodness from the fruit as you possibly can, saving you time and money. Just remember to let the lemon cool for a minute before you start slicing.

What happens if you microwave a lemon?

Before slicing the lemon or lime, microwave the fruit on high for 20 to 30 seconds or until warm. As the microwave heats the fruit from the inside out, the juice capsules burst within the fruit. Once the fruit has cooled enough to handle (about 30 seconds), slice it open and juice as normal.

How long do you put lemon water in the microwave to clean it?

Fill a microwave glass measuring jug or bowl with water until around the halfway point. Slice a lemon in half and place in the water, squeezing so some of the juice is released. Put on high for three minutes.

What can you do with hard lemons?

Next time you have a lemon that’s a little hard, don’t just throw it out. You can zest it with a citrus zester or microplane and freeze the zest to use in a recipe or even just to add flavor to tonight’s vegetable side dish.

Can lemon be heated?

When lemon juice is boiled, it reduces, which means that water evaporates. This concentrates the flavor. This concentration and cooking also changes the flavor. The now cooked juice, while still clearly identifiable as lemon, will be much less bright.

How do you get the most juice out of a lemon without a juicer?

Microwave It
Pop the lemon in the microwave for 20-30 seconds (again, before cutting it open). This has a similar effect to rolling the lemon in that it causes some of the membranes inside to burst and release their juice. Plus, a warm lemon is a lot softer and easier to squeeze than a cold lemon.

What are the juiciest lemons?

Buying the juiciest lemons

  • Meyer, although not a pure lemon (they’re a natural hybrid between a lemon and an orange) are the juiciest, though they can also be quite pricey.
  • Fino, Primofiori, or Lapithkiotiki (from the Mediterranean) are all really juicy varieties.

Are hard lemons still good?

Over time lemons lose some of their water and thus lose their firmness. If your specimen yields only slightly to pressure, it’s perfectly fine. But if it’s already shriveled, the rind wrinkly, or the whole fruit squishy, it’s probably best to throw it out for quality reasons.

Why did my lemon get hard?

When lemons are left in room temperature settings, they grow tough in approximately a week. This occurs due to a loss of moisture, or desiccation. The color dulls, the lemon shrinks, and the outer rind becomes hard.

How do you keep lemons from getting hard?

Lemons are best kept in the fridge—period. Stashed in the fridge in the crisper drawer or on a shelf, fresh lemons will keep for two weeks or more. If you really want your lemons to last, pop them in a sealed container (there are even specialty produce keepers for this purpose) or a zip-top bag.
